Recipe: Orecchiette With Mixed Greens And Goat Cheese

This is one of my favorite go-to recipes. It’s so flavorful and easy to make, plus you can adjust all the ingredients to taste and preference.

Ingredients

1 cup dry orecchiette pasta

2 cups mixed greens or butter lettuce

1 handful of sun-dried tomatoes, chopped

3 tablespoons crumbled goat cheese (can add more/less to taste)

2 tablespoons grated Parmesan, plus more for garnish

Salt + pepper

Directions

Bring a medium pot of salted water to a boil over high heat. Add the pasta and cook per instructions. Drain, reserve 1/2 cup of the water.

Mix the salad greens with the sun-dried tomatoes, goat cheese, and Parmesan (all these things you can really add to taste).

Add the warm pasta, plus the 1/2 cup of reserved pasta water. Toss everything in bowl, then add a pinch of salt and pepper, and garnish with some more parmesan cheese.

Recipe adapted from Giada De Laurentis, Food Network.
